Microsoft is on a roll:
  • January 2023 - 10000 in the whole MS, part of it affecting gaming in studios like 343 or Zenimax/Bethesda
  • July 2023 - 276 (customer service, support, sales, maybe not in gaming)
  • January 2024 - 1900 in gaming
  • September 2024 - 650 in gaming
